// eslint.sonarjs.config.mjs // STANDALONE flat config for the cognitive-complexity ratchet // (scripts/check/check-cognitive-complexity.mjs). // // Intentionally does NOT extend the project's main eslint.config.mjs — it // enables ONLY `sonarjs/cognitive-complexity` so its violation count is // isolated from the main lint's ratcheted warning budget (3653). // // Run via: // node_modules/.bin/eslint --no-config-lookup \ // --config eslint.sonarjs.config.mjs --format json src open-sse import tseslint from "typescript-eslint"; import sonarjs from "eslint-plugin-sonarjs"; /** @type {import("eslint").Linter.Config[]} */ const sonarisCognitiveConfig = [ { files: ["src/**/*.{ts,tsx}", "open-sse/**/*.{ts,tsx}"], languageOptions: { parser: tseslint.parser, parserOptions: { ecmaVersion: 2022, sourceType: "module", ecmaFeatures: { jsx: true }, }, }, plugins: { sonarjs }, // Silence inline disable directives that reference rules from OTHER plugins // (react-hooks, @next/next, etc.) that this standalone config does NOT load. // Without noInlineConfig those produce error-severity "rule not found" noise // that pollutes and destabilises the violation count. linterOptions: { noInlineConfig: true, reportUnusedDisableDirectives: "off", }, // ONLY this one sonarjs rule. Keep the list minimal so the reported count // is exactly "functions over the cognitive-complexity threshold". rules: { "sonarjs/cognitive-complexity": ["error", 15], }, }, // Ignore everything that is not first-party src/open-sse production code so // the count is not polluted by tests, type declarations, or build output. { ignores: [ "**/*.test.ts", "**/*.test.tsx", "**/__tests__/**", "**/*.d.ts", "node_modules/**", "electron/node_modules/**", "electron/dist-electron/**", ".next/**", ".build/**", "dist/**", "coverage/**", ], }, ]; export default sonarisCognitiveConfig;
